payload
Cargo or the weight of cargo.

pillars
Structure that holds up a car's roof.

platform
The base n which a car is built that defines its size, weight and strength.

Porsche Stability Management (a.k.a. electronic stability system)
Refers to a computer-controlled antilock braking system that keeps a car on course.

port (multi-point) fuel injection (a.k.a. fuel injection, electronic fuel injection, EFI)
A fuel-supply system that has taken the carburetor's place, increasing vehicle reliability, efficiency and emissions performance

power ratings
Measure of an engine's force

Precision Control System (a.k.a. electronic stability system)
Refers to a computer-controlled antilock braking system that keeps a car on course

prep fee (a.k.a. dealer preparation fee)
The fee charged by a dealer for preparing a car for lease

production vehicle
A vehicle produced for public sale

purchase option
The opportunity given to a lessee to buy a car at the end of a lease.
